Graham Ordinary: 1700's Lodge, Stunning Views

Graham Ordinary is a lodge built in the late 1700's that sits on 23 acres at 1,720ft on the south eastern slopes of Flat Top Mountain in Bedford, VA. The property shares a border with George Washington and Jefferson National Forest amidst ancient trees and boulders which provide a rustic, comfortable getaway. 1.5 miles from the Blue Ridge Parkway, there are many activities right out the front door - hiking, fishing, cycling, bird watching, wine tours and more.
